Project Description

San Francisco YMCA in secured $17.5 million in NMTC financing for the redevelopment of the historic Chinatown YMCA in downtown San Francisco. The YMCA advances education achievement for youth and provides recreational activities for the low-income community. The funding leveraged the existing building value, prior costs incurred over several years of redevelopment planning and capital campaign funds to maximize the net value of the NMTC equity. Funding occurred in January 2008 and the project was completed in 2010.
